South Sudan Law Society says 11 cases in the Military Court Marshall of former Yei River State are ready for ruling.
 
A lawyer with the Law Society Taban Oliver explains that 16 cases were presented since the beginning of the court Marshall now 11 awaits ruling and five to be completed in the coming weeks.
 
Taban reveals during the judgment they expect all citizens to be present for the hearing.
 
Another lawyer Khansa Ibrahim says without form eight South Sudan Law society will not defend a victim.
 
She advises citizen to always have form eight because it is easy to establish the facts especially on cases of rape and beating.
 
Lawyer Ibrahim encourages every person to bring their case forward for justice to prevail.
 
The advocates were talking on Saturday through live program on Radio Easter in Yei.
